100 Examples of sentences containing the noun "climbing"
Definition
"Climbing" as a common noun refers to the activity or sport of ascending or moving upwards in a vertical or steep direction, often involving the use of hands and feet. It can also denote the act of rising or increasing in position, status, or intensity.
